Marking a significant return to large-scale physical events and celebrating its 12th anniversary, OnePlus has officially scheduled a major live keynote for December 17 in Bengaluru, India. This highly anticipated gathering is set to unveil two new devices for both the Indian and global markets: the OnePlus 15R smartphone and the OnePlus Pad Go 2 tablet. A New Era of Smartphone Performance

The centerpiece of the announcement, the OnePlus 15R, is poised to set a new benchmark in the smartphone industry by being the first device to launch with the cutting-edge Snapdragon 8 Gen 5 System-on-Chip. This exclusive debut, born from a close co-optimization effort with Qualcomm, promises a substantial leap in processing power and efficiency. Complementing this powerful core is a visually stunning 1.5K AMOLED display that boasts an exceptionally fluid 165Hz refresh rate, a sharp 450 PPI pixel density, and an impressive peak brightness of 1,800 nits, ensuring clarity and vibrancy even in direct sunlight. Beyond raw performance and display quality, OnePlus is heavily investing in computational photography. The 15R will integrate the brand’s proprietary Detailmax Engine and borrow advanced camera technologies directly from the flagship OnePlus 15 series. Features such as Ultra Clear Mode for high-resolution shots, Clear Burst for capturing fast-moving action, and the Clear Night Engine for low-light photography signal an ambition to deliver a top-tier imaging experience that fully leverages the new chipset’s capabilities.

Expanding the Tablet Ecosystem

The introduction of the OnePlus Pad Go 2 signaled a deliberate and strategic move to strengthen the company’s presence in the competitive mid-range tablet market. This device was engineered not merely as a successor but as a refined tool for both media consumption and productivity. It featured a large 12.1-inch screen with a crisp 2.8K resolution, which, combined with 900 nits of peak brightness and support for Dolby Vision, delivered a rich and immersive viewing experience. However, the tablet’s defining feature was the debut of the self-developed Open Canvas software. This innovative interface was designed specifically to enhance multitasking on the expansive display, providing users with intuitive controls for activating split-screen mode and managing multiple windows effortlessly.
